Design Rationale Capture as Knowledge Acquisition

Abstract This paper introduces a panel to be held at the Knowledge Acquisition Track of the Machine Learning Workshop (ML91). This panel will focus on the problem of acquiring design rationale knowledge from humans for later reuse. The design of tools for design rationale capture reveals several fundamental issues for knowledge acquisition, such as the relationships among formality and expressiveness of representations, and kinds of automated support for elicitation and analysis of knowledge. This paper sets the background for discussion by identifying dimensions of a design space for design rationale tools, and then includes position statements from each panelist arguing for various positions in this space.

[1]  Thomas R. Gruber,et al.  Interactive Acquisition of Justifications: Learning "Why" by Being Told "What" , 1991 .

[2]  Raymond McCall,et al.  JANUS: integrating hypertext with a knowledge-based design environment , 1989, Hypertext.

[3]  C. Baudin,et al.  Recovering rationale for design changes: a knowledge-based approach , 1990, 1990 IEEE International Conference on Systems, Man, and Cybernetics Conference Proceedings.

[4]  M. V. Wilkes,et al.  Can Machines Think? , 1953, Proceedings of the IRE.

[5]  John H. Boose,et al.  Refining Problem-Solving Knowledge in Repertory Grids Using a Consultation Mechanism , 1988, Int. J. Man Mach. Stud..

[6]  John H. Boose,et al.  Recent progress in ACQUINAS: a knowledge acquisition workbench , 1989 .

[7]  Brian Falkenhainer,et al.  An integration of qualitative and quantitative knowledge , 1990 .

[8]  Jack Mostow,et al.  Automated reuse of design plans , 1989, Artif. Intell. Eng..

[9]  Brian R. Gaines,et al.  Induction of inference rules for expert systems , 1986 .

[10]  Wolfe Mays Can Machines Think , 1952 .

[11]  Thomas R. Gruber,et al.  Learning why by being told what: interactive acquisition of justifications , 1991, IEEE Expert.

[12]  Thomas R. Gruber,et al.  Design Knowledge and Design Rationale: A Framework for Representation, Capture, and Use , 1991 .

[13]  Jeffrey M. Bradshaw,et al.  Design knowledge capture and alternatives generation using possibility tables in Canard , 1990 .

[14]  Tom M. Mitchell,et al.  LEAP: A Learning Apprentice for VLSI Design , 1985, IJCAI.

[15]  Sanjaya Addanki,et al.  Reasoning About Assumptions in Graphs of Models , 1989, IJCAI.

[16]  Benjamin Kuipers,et al.  QPC: A Compiler from Physical Models into Qualitative Differential Equations , 1990, AAAI.